Subject: Tilecache cut-over complete

Team,

The cut-over of the Pinemark tile-rendering cache layer finished Tuesday night. Old renderer nodes are drained; all map traffic now hits the new Lattice cache tier. Eviction is LRU with a 6-hour TTL, and warm-up ran clean. For future reference, the production settings the service now runs with are listed below.

service settings:
novath:
  pin: 1396
  tenant: pelys
  seal: seal_ccc035e1
  metrics_host: metrics.novath.qorvelworks.test
  standby_team: fraeth
  escalation: drueth-zorok
  nonce: 61d508

09:10 — Noticed CPU spikes on the Glimmerport websocket tier after enabling permessage-deflate. 09:25 — Bandwidth dropped 40% but compression contexts doubled memory per connection. 09:50 — Disabled context takeover to cap memory; throughput acceptable. 10:15 — Decided to keep compression only for payloads over 1 KB, which balanced both constraints. Action item: document the threshold in the gateway config. The rollout that applied this change is identified by the token below.

session token of yajof-bagef = htk4_937d

TICKET #— Thumbnail queue stalled, vault locked

The Greywick thumbnail generation queue at Fennhall Media has stalled because the worker's credential vault auto-locked after three failed renewals. Please do not restart the workers; queued jobs will drain once the vault is reopened. Unlock it from the admin console by entering the recovery passphrase provided below.

strongbox words: praath-queniel-holax-druael-jorath-noveth-druok